Brief Background of Brislington Brislington is known to have actually been occupied in Roman times because the remains of a Roman villa dating from around AD 270-300 were located when Winchester Roadway was being built in1899. The suite was most likely the centre of a huge estate and is believed to have actually been ruined by fire regarding AD 367, perhaps after a raid by Irish pirates.


Initially it was served by the Augustinian canons from Keynsham Abbey which was started in regarding 1166. The present church dates from 1420 and was built by the fifth Baron Thomas la Warr. The family (later the de la Warrs) were the lords of the mansion from the late 12th Century to the late 16th Century; they were to give their name to the state of Delaware in the United States.

In medieval times Brislington became a well recognized place of pilgrimage, measuring up to Walsingham and Canterbury. In about 1276 Roger la Warr founded the Church of St Anne-in- the-Wood near a divine well, which was said to have recovery powers. The church was twice gone to by Henry VII, in 1486 and once again in 1502 come with by his queen, Elizabeth of York.

The structure came under decay, but traces were still noticeable up until the early 20th Century. Brislington had two mansion homes. The medieval moated and prepared chateau residence of the de la Warrs stood in West Community Lane. Components of this mansion dated back to Saxon times. It later became understood as Estate Ranch and was demolished in 1933 to make method for the Imperial Sports Ground.




The second, the Arno's Team of buildings, (consisting of 'The Black Castle') was developed by William Reeve, an abundant eccentric Quake copper smelter. In 1850 the residence ended up being a Roman Catholic convent and woman's correctional institution college, staying so up until 1948. brislington bristol map.

A number of homes for wealthy sellers were constructed along the valley of the Brislington Brook. Potential affluent merchants looking to run away to the countryside would certainly construct homes in Brislington.


An additional sight of the Hermitage at Wick Residence remains in the collection of the Bristol City Art Gallery (K4907). Brislington is 2 miles south-east of Bristol city centre and was defined as one of the prettiest villages in Somerset in the very early 19th century. Wick Residence, constructed in circa 1790, was a vacation home that stood in sixty acres of pleasure grounds.

Most major industry enclosed the 1980s, and almost all of the initial structures have actually currently been demolished. Brislington was still quite a rural, semi-agricultural community till well right into 20th Century. At the turn of the century there were sixteen primary functioning ranches in the town and numerous small-holdings, in addition to market yards.
